Looking back, what do you think were the three qualities, skills, or areas of knowledge that were most impactful in your journey? What advice do you have for folks who are early in their journey in terms of how they can best develop or improve on these?
Looking back, three qualities have been most impactful in my journey: discipline, creativity, and faith. Discipline kept me consistent through the ups and downs—whether in school, content creation, or building my business. Creativity allowed me to see possibilities where others saw limitations, turning everyday experiences into content and finding innovative ways to share meaningful stories. It’s also opened doors to collaborate with some of the most renowned brands. Faith has been my foundation, giving me clarity, purpose, and the confidence to keep pushing forward, even when the path is uncertain.
For anyone early in their journey: develop discipline by showing up daily, even when motivation wanes; nurture creativity by staying curious and embracing new experiences; and ground yourself in something bigger than yourself, whether that’s faith, purpose, or vision. Together, these three will keep you moving forward, no matter the challenges.
